Minimum Qualifications EDUCATION & REQUIREMENTS:
Education Level required: Master’s degree in Urban Planning, Environmental Science, or equivalent.
Equivalent Experience required: Minimum 7+ years’ in planning/environmental analysis with strong background in real estate project management.
Knowledge required: Background in urban and regional planning, historic preservation, environmental analysis and review under CEQR, SEQRA and NEPA; managing contracts and working with consultants, governmental agencies, community groups.

Duties Description BASIC FUNCTION: Assist VP of Planning & Environmental Review in conducting and analyzing planning and environmental studies for ESD projects. Oversee planning & environmental review for ESD projects and ESD subsidiaries including SEQRA review, historic preservation consultation, and land use and planning analysis.

WORK PERFORMED:
• Manage environmental, planning, historic preservation, urban design and aesthetic reviews for ESD real estate projects. Make recommendations relative to land use, planning and aesthetic considerations of projects, and in consultation with Supervisor, inform and help shape general project plans.
• Review and manage State environmental impact statements (EISs) and assessments.
• Prepare and present environmental section of ESD Board materials.
• Assist in coordination with state and municipal agencies, community groups and development teams.
• Provide guidance and advise ESD project team and development team on planning issues, historic preservation, contaminated site cleanup and environmental permit processes.
• Prepare RFPs and conduct consultant selection process for ESD lead agency assessments and EISs.
• Supervise consultant contracts for the preparation of Environmental Impact Statements and planning documents.
• Assist in preparation of agreements with sponsors and consultants.
